On Wed, 15 Sep 1999, Davin McCall wrote:

> Just mucking around with C++ recently, and noticed that the following
> short program takes *ages* for gpp to compile (without optimization or
> anything, command line: gpp -o test.exe test.cpp).

Does this happen for this program only, or for *any* C++ program.

> Can anyone fill me in on why it takes so long?

Add -v to the compilation command line and tell here which subprogram 
invoked by gpp takes most of the time to execute.
